excel怎么摘出数

excel怎么摘出数

一、EXCEL摘出数的方法

使用函数、数据筛选、数据透视表、VBA宏是从Excel中摘出数据的常见方法。使用函数是最常见且简单的方法之一,包括SUM、AVERAGE、MIN、MAX等函数。数据筛选功能可以快速过滤并提取符合特定条件的数据,而数据透视表可以帮助用户对大规模数据进行分析和总结。最后,VBA宏则可以用于自动化复杂的数据提取任务。接下来将详细介绍其中的使用函数方法。

使用函数是一种非常方便的方式,可以根据需要对数据进行计算和提取。例如,SUM函数可以用来求和,AVERAGE函数可以计算平均值,MIN和MAX函数分别可以找出最小值和最大值。以下是这些函数的具体用法和实例:

二、使用SUM函数摘出数

SUM函数是Excel中最常用的函数之一,用于计算一组数值的总和。其基本语法为=SUM(number1, [number2], ...),其中number1number2等是要求和的数值或单元格范围。

  1. 基本用法

    • 在一个单元格中输入=SUM(A1:A10),将计算A1到A10单元格的总和。
    • 如果需要计算不连续的单元格,可以使用逗号分隔,例如=SUM(A1, A3, A5)
  2. 求和条件

    • 使用SUMIF函数可以对符合特定条件的数值进行求和,其语法为=SUMIF(range, criteria, [sum_range])
    • 例如,=SUMIF(A1:A10, ">5")将计算A1到A10单元格中大于5的数值总和。

三、使用AVERAGE函数摘出数

AVERAGE函数用于计算一组数值的平均值,其基本语法为=AVERAGE(number1, [number2], ...)

  1. 基本用法

    • 在一个单元格中输入=AVERAGE(B1:B10),将计算B1到B10单元格的平均值。
    • 类似于SUM函数,如果需要计算不连续的单元格,可以使用逗号分隔,例如=AVERAGE(B1, B3, B5)
  2. 条件平均值

    • 使用AVERAGEIF函数可以对符合特定条件的数值进行平均值计算,其语法为=AVERAGEIF(range, criteria, [average_range])
    • 例如,=AVERAGEIF(B1:B10, "<10")将计算B1到B10单元格中小于10的数值的平均值。

四、使用MIN和MAX函数摘出数

MIN和MAX函数分别用于找出一组数值中的最小值和最大值。其基本语法为=MIN(number1, [number2], ...)=MAX(number1, [number2], ...)

  1. 基本用法

    • 在一个单元格中输入=MIN(C1:C10),将找出C1到C10单元格中的最小值。
    • 类似地,输入=MAX(C1:C10)将找出C1到C10单元格中的最大值。
  2. 条件最小值和最大值

    • 使用MINIFS和MAXIFS函数可以对符合特定条件的数值进行最小值和最大值的计算,其语法为=MINIFS(min_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)=MAXIFS(max_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)
    • 例如,=MINIFS(C1:C10, C1:C10, ">2")将找出C1到C10单元格中大于2的数值的最小值。

五、使用数据筛选摘出数

数据筛选功能可以帮助用户快速过滤并提取符合特定条件的数据。以下是数据筛选功能的使用步骤:

  1. 启用筛选

    • 选择包含数据的单元格区域,点击“数据”选项卡,然后点击“筛选”按钮。
    • 此时,选定区域的每列标题旁边将出现一个下拉箭头。
  2. 应用筛选条件

    • 点击要筛选的列标题旁边的下拉箭头,选择需要的筛选条件。例如,可以选择“数值筛选”中的“大于”选项,然后输入特定的数值。
    • 筛选条件应用后,Excel将只显示符合条件的数据行。
  3. 提取筛选结果

    • 选择并复制筛选后的数据,然后粘贴到新的工作表或单元格区域中,以便进一步处理或保存。

六、使用数据透视表摘出数

数据透视表是一种强大的数据分析工具,可以帮助用户对大规模数据进行总结和提取。以下是数据透视表的使用步骤:

  1. 创建数据透视表

    • 选择包含数据的单元格区域,点击“插入”选项卡,然后点击“数据透视表”按钮。
    • 在弹出的对话框中,选择数据源和放置数据透视表的位置,然后点击“确定”。
  2. 配置数据透视表字段

    • 在数据透视表字段列表中,将需要分析的字段拖动到行、列和数值区域。
    • 例如,可以将“销售员”字段拖动到行区域,将“销售额”字段拖动到数值区域,以便按销售员总结销售额。
  3. 应用筛选和排序

    • 在数据透视表中,可以使用筛选和排序功能对数据进行进一步的提取和分析。
    • 例如,可以对销售额进行降序排序,以找出销售额最高的销售员。

七、使用VBA宏摘出数

VBA(Visual Basic for Applications)宏是一种编程工具,可以帮助用户自动化复杂的数据提取任务。以下是使用VBA宏摘出数的基本步骤:

  1. 启用开发工具

    • 点击“文件”选项卡,选择“选项”,在弹出的对话框中选择“自定义功能区”,然后勾选“开发工具”选项。
  2. 编写和运行宏

    • 点击“开发工具”选项卡,选择“宏”,然后点击“录制宏”按钮。
    • 在录制宏的过程中,执行需要自动化的操作,例如数据筛选、复制和粘贴等。
    • 录制完成后,点击“停止录制”按钮。
  3. 编辑宏代码

    • 在“开发工具”选项卡中,点击“Visual Basic”按钮,打开VBA编辑器。
    • 在VBA编辑器中,可以查看和编辑录制的宏代码,以便进行更复杂的操作。
  4. 运行宏

    • 在“开发工具”选项卡中,点击“宏”按钮,选择需要运行的宏,然后点击“运行”按钮。

八、结合多种方法摘出数

在实际应用中,用户可以根据具体需求,结合多种方法摘出数。例如,先使用数据筛选功能提取符合条件的数据,然后使用SUM函数计算提取数据的总和,或者使用VBA宏自动化整个数据提取和计算过程。

  1. 示例:结合筛选和SUM函数

    • 首先,使用数据筛选功能提取符合特定条件的数据。
    • 然后,在筛选结果中使用SUM函数计算总和,例如=SUM(D1:D10)
  2. 示例:结合数据透视表和VBA宏

    • 首先,使用数据透视表对大规模数据进行总结和提取。
    • 然后,编写VBA宏自动化数据透视表的创建和配置过程,以便快速生成所需的分析结果。

九、总结

摘出数是Excel中常见的操作,通过使用函数、数据筛选、数据透视表和VBA宏,用户可以高效地提取和计算所需的数据。在具体应用中,可以根据需求选择适合的方法,或者结合多种方法,实现更加复杂和自动化的数据处理任务。通过不断学习和实践,用户可以掌握Excel中的各种数据提取技巧,提高数据处理和分析的效率。

相关问答FAQs:

1. 如何在Excel中提取特定的数字?

  • 问题描述:我想从一个包含文字和数字的Excel单元格中提取出数字,应该如何操作?
  • 回答:您可以使用Excel的文本函数和数值函数来提取单元格中的数字。例如,使用文本函数中的SUBSTITUTE函数来替换掉非数字字符,然后再使用数值函数中的VALUE函数将文本转换为数字。

2. 如何在Excel中摘取多个单元格中的数字并求和?

  • 问题描述:我有一列包含数字的单元格,我希望能够将这些数字摘取出来并求和,有什么方法可以实现吗?
  • 回答:您可以使用Excel的SUM函数结合文本函数中的MID和LEN函数来摘取多个单元格中的数字并求和。通过使用MID函数确定数字的位置,并结合LEN函数确定数字的长度,然后再将这些数字作为SUM函数的参数进行求和。

3. 如何在Excel中提取某一范围内的最大或最小数字?

  • 问题描述:我有一列包含数字的单元格,我想提取出这些数字中的最大或最小值,应该如何操作?
  • 回答:您可以使用Excel的MAX函数或MIN函数来提取某一范围内的最大或最小数字。只需要将包含数字的单元格作为函数的参数即可。如果要提取最大值,使用MAX函数;如果要提取最小值,使用MIN函数。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4727514

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部